'Have Yourself A Merry Little Christmas'

Christmas has always been a time for family reunions, even those who never visit home make an exception

This year, however, it looks like Christmas will be a sombre affair all thanks to the coronavirus (COVID-19) pandemic, which has left many lives devastated and continues to wreak havoc in different countries across the world. Most of the time when we speak of COVID-19, we tend to concentrate more on the economic side of things, and rightfully so, because our finances are a very important part of our lives!

The outbreak of this virus has hurt different aspects of Batswana's lives. Some have lost their loved ones and were not able to attend funerals due to the strict COVID-19 regulations put in place to curb the spread of the virus, which seems to be spreading like a veld fire, especially in the Greater Gaborone zone.
